DescriptionTG(20:2n6/24:1(15Z)/22:4(7Z,10Z,13Z,16Z)) belongs to the family of triradyglycerols, which are glycerolipids lipids containing a common glycerol backbone to which at least one fatty acyl group is esterified. Their general formula is [R1]OCC(CO[R2])O[R3]. TG(20:2n6/24:1(15Z)/22:4(7Z,10Z,13Z,16Z)) is made up of one 11Z,14Z-eicosadienoyl(R1), one 15Z-tetracosenoyl(R2), and one 7Z,10Z,13Z,16Z-docosatetraenoyl(R3).

Description belongs to the class of organic compounds known as triacylglycerols. These are glycerides consisting of three fatty acid chains covalently bonded to a glycerol molecule through ester linkages.
